Summary

This study aims to clarify relations between brain oscillations and two cognitive functions: cognitive control and memory.

Interventions

DEVICE

Sham device

Intervention which uses an inactive form of stimulation via electrodes on the scalp.

DEVICE

STARSTIM Device in-phase

Intervention that uses the Starstim tES device to introduce transcranial alternating current stimulation (tACS) in the form of in-phase theta (\~3.5 to \~7.5 Hz) via electrodes on the scalp.

DEVICE

STARSTIM Device anti-phase

Intervention that uses the Starstim tES device to introduce transcranial alternating current stimulation (tACS) in the form of anti-phase stimulation via electrodes on the scalp.
